Tiber Island

Tiber Island, Rome, Metropolitan City of Rome Capital

Island sacred to healing since Roman times, shaped like a ship, with a still-operating hospital.

This guide to Tiber Island in Rome opens in 293 BCE, as plague grips the city and the Senate sends envoys all the way to Greece to fetch a sacred serpent from a temple of the healing god Aesculapius. It follows what happened when the ship carrying the snake reached this island, and how Romans came to treat the spot as a sanctuary for the sick, who slept there hoping the god would visit their dreams. Patients lay down in the temple grounds hoping the god would visit them in a dream and reveal a cure.
